Import bundles define a group of entities to be added or
updated in the target environment.
Before you create an import bundle, you must have already
created an export bundle, added entities, and set the bundle's state
to Bundled.
To create an import bundle and apply it to the target
environment:
-
If you have not already copied the XML from the export
bundle, do so now:
-
Select and search for
the bundle.
-
Copy the XML from the Bundle Detail zone to the clipboard (or to a text file).
-
Log on to the target environment.
-
Select .
-
In the Bundle Actions zone, click Edit XML.
-
Paste the contents of the clipboard (or text file if you
created one) into the Bundle Detail zone.
-
Make any necessary changes to the XML and click Save. The status of the import bundle is set to Pending.
Note: Use caution when editing the XML to avoid validation errors.
-
To remove entities from the import bundle or change their
sequence, click Edit. Enter your changes and
click Save to exit the Edit dialog.
-
When you are ready to apply the bundle, click
Apply. The import bundle state is set to
Applied and the entities are added or updated in the target environment.
